A late Victorian halls-adjoining semi-detached house situated in the popular location on the eastern side of the town with in close proximity of the town centre and railway station. The accommodation, as detailed on the floorplan, comprises two ground floor reception rooms, the sitting room, to the front, has a bay window. The dining room has window to rear and an understairs cupboard. The kitchen has a range of wall and base cupboards with worktops and a door leading to the rear garden. The family bathroom lies beyond the kitchen. On the first floor there are three bedrooms coming off the landing and access to the loft.

Outside, there is a small area of front garden behind a low level wall and side access which leads to the rear garden which is laid to predominantly to grass and is southerly facing.

The property offers great potential for further updating and extending.

Situation

This home is ideally positioned in a sought-after location, just under half a mile from the town centre. Horsham is a lively and historic market town, offering a great mix of well-known high street names and independent shops, including a large John Lewis and Waitrose.

The Carfax hosts popular award-winning markets twice a week, perfect for sourcing fresh local produce. East Street features an excellent variety of restaurants, from independent favourites such as Monte Forte to familiar names like Wagamama, Pizza Express, Côte and Miller & Carter. There are also plenty of leisure options nearby, including a leisure centre with swimming facilities close to Horsham Park, while The Capitol provides both cinema and theatre entertainment along with Everyman cinema located in Piries Place.

Horsham Station is conveniently located within 0.3 miles, offering direct routes to Gatwick in around 17 minutes and London Victoria in approximately 56 minutes. Road connections are also strong, with straightforward access to the M23 and onward to the M25.

The home is also well placed for a number of well-regarded schools, including Kingslea Primary, Heron Way Primary, The Forest School and Millais Secondary School.
